BASTROP, Texas— The Bastrop County firefighters have contained a fire near State Highway 95.
Officials say a trash burn caused the fire near 2300 SH 95, between Elgin and Bastrop. The Travis County STAR Flight assisted in containing the fire.
Officials issued citations to those who violated a countywide burn ban—a ban in effect until November.
No injuries have been reported.
